Planning appeal decision

Dismissed9 January 20243323209

Land off Upper Pike Law, Scapegoat Hill, West Yorks, HD7 4NS

demolition of existing storage building and erection of new storage building (same siting and footprint)

Authority
Kirklees Metropolitan Council
Appeal type
minor · Planning Appeal
Procedure
Written Representations
Development
employment-industrial · Other minor developments
Inspector
Wilkinson F

Main issues, as the Inspector framed them

  • whether the proposal would be inappropriate development in the Green Belt including the effect on the openness of the Green Belt
  • the effect of the proposal on highway safety
  • whether any harm by reason of inappropriateness, and any other harm, would be clearly outweighed by other considerations, so as to amount to the very special circumstances required to justify the proposal

What decided it

The proposal would result in an unacceptable impact on highway safety due to inadequate visibility splays and insufficient access width on a busy road near a bend, which is a matter of overriding concern.

Framework references: 152, 154, 9, 12, 13

Plan policies cited: Policy LP57, Policy LP59, Policy LP24a, Policy LP21
